About Transportation Law in Norway:

Transportation in Norway is governed by a set of laws and regulations that dictate how various modes of transportation operate within the country. Whether it's road, rail, air, or sea transportation, there are legal frameworks in place to ensure safety, efficiency, and accountability in the industry.

Why You May Need a Lawyer:

There are several situations where you may need a lawyer specializing in transportation law in Norway. These can include disputes with insurance companies, accidents involving multiple parties, violation of transportation regulations, or issues related to cargo transportation. A lawyer can help protect your rights and navigate the legal complexities of transportation law.

Local Laws Overview:

In Norway, transportation laws cover a wide range of areas such as traffic regulations, shipping laws, aviation regulations, and railway safety standards. Key aspects that are particularly relevant include speed limits on roads, licensing requirements for drivers, liability in case of accidents, and environmental standards for transportation companies.

Frequently Asked Questions:

Q: What are the speed limits for vehicles in Norway?

A: The speed limit on most roads in Norway is 80 km/h, but it can vary depending on the type of road and location. Make sure to adhere to the posted speed limits to avoid fines or penalties.

Q: What should I do if I'm involved in a car accident in Norway?

A: If you're involved in a car accident in Norway, make sure to exchange contact and insurance information with the other party, report the accident to the police, and seek medical attention if necessary. Consider consulting a lawyer to guide you through the legal process.

Q: Are there regulations for transporting goods by sea in Norway?

A: Yes, Norway has regulations governing the transportation of goods by sea to ensure safety and environmental protection. Companies involved in maritime transportation must comply with these regulations to avoid legal issues.
